Understanding Waste Management in the UK

Waste management refers to the collection, transportation, processing, recycling, and disposal of waste materials. In the United Kingdom, this industry has evolved significantly over recent decades, driven by environmental regulations, technological advancements, and growing public awareness about sustainability. Local authorities, private companies, and specialized contractors work together to ensure waste is handled efficiently and in compliance with environmental standards. The sector manages everything from residential rubbish and commercial waste to hazardous materials and construction debris. Effective waste management reduces pollution, conserves natural resources, and minimizes the environmental impact of human activity.

Recycling Processes and Their Importance

Recycling processes form a cornerstone of modern waste management strategies in the United Kingdom. These processes involve collecting recyclable materials such as paper, cardboard, glass, plastics, and metals, then transforming them into new products. Once collected, recyclables are transported to specialized facilities where they undergo sorting, cleaning, and processing. Paper and cardboard are pulped and reformed, while plastics are melted down and remolded into new items. Glass can be crushed and melted repeatedly without losing quality, and metals are smelted for reuse in manufacturing. Recycling reduces the need for raw material extraction, lowers energy consumption, and decreases landfill dependency. The UK government has set ambitious recycling targets, encouraging both households and businesses to participate actively in recycling schemes.

Material Sorting Techniques and Technologies

Material sorting is a critical step in waste management that determines the efficiency and effectiveness of recycling efforts. In the United Kingdom, sorting occurs at multiple stages, beginning with source separation by households and businesses, followed by further refinement at processing facilities. Modern sorting facilities use a combination of manual labor and advanced technologies such as optical scanners, magnetic separators, and air classifiers to identify and separate different material types. Optical sorters use infrared sensors to distinguish between various plastics, while magnets extract ferrous metals from mixed waste streams. Proper sorting ensures that materials are clean and uncontaminated, which improves their quality and marketability for recycling. Contamination remains a significant challenge, as improperly sorted waste can compromise entire batches of recyclables.

Waste Storage Solutions and Best Practices

Waste storage is an essential component of effective waste management, ensuring materials are contained safely and hygienically until collection and processing. In the United Kingdom, waste storage solutions vary depending on the type and volume of waste generated. Residential areas typically use wheelie bins and recycling boxes provided by local councils, while commercial and industrial sites may require larger containers such as skips, compactors, or specialized storage units for hazardous materials. Proper waste storage prevents environmental contamination, reduces odors, and minimizes pest attraction. Businesses are encouraged to implement waste segregation systems that separate general waste, recyclables, and hazardous materials at the point of generation. Regular collection schedules and adequate storage capacity are crucial to preventing overflow and ensuring compliance with health and safety regulations.

The Role of Legislation and Environmental Regulations

The United Kingdom has implemented comprehensive legislation to regulate waste management and promote environmental protection. The Environmental Protection Act, Waste Framework Directive, and various recycling targets set by national and local governments establish standards for waste handling, disposal, and recycling. These regulations require businesses and waste management providers to obtain appropriate licenses, follow safe disposal procedures, and meet recycling quotas. Landfill taxes incentivize waste diversion, while Extended Producer Responsibility schemes hold manufacturers accountable for the end-of-life management of their products. Compliance with these regulations is monitored through inspections, audits, and reporting requirements. The regulatory framework continues to evolve, with increasing emphasis on circular economy principles that prioritize waste prevention, reuse, and resource recovery over disposal.

The waste management industry in the United Kingdom is embracing innovation to address emerging challenges and improve sustainability outcomes. Advances in waste-to-energy technologies allow non-recyclable waste to be converted into electricity or heat, reducing landfill dependence. Smart bin systems equipped with sensors monitor fill levels and optimize collection routes, improving efficiency and reducing carbon emissions. Chemical recycling processes are being developed to handle complex plastics that traditional mechanical recycling cannot process. Increased investment in infrastructure, research, and public engagement is driving progress toward a circular economy where waste is minimized and resources are continuously reused. As environmental concerns grow and regulations tighten, the waste management sector will continue to play a crucial role in protecting the environment and supporting sustainable development across the United Kingdom.
